logo
Welcome Guest! To enable all features please Giriş or Kayıt.

Bildirim

Icon
Error

Ayarlar
Son mesaja git Go to first unread
Gkhn  
#1 Gönderildi : 11 Eylül 2016 Pazar 17:28:52(UTC)
Gkhn

Sıralama: Newbie

Gruplar: Registered
Katılan: 8.09.2016(UTC)
Mesajlar: 2
Turkey

Merhabalar

SQL ile amatörce ilgilenme devresinde Mehmet Zeki Kır bey'in youtube'taki videolarına rastladım. Verimli anlatımları için hem teşekkür etmek istedim, hem de bir soru sormak istedim.

Şirketimiz muhasebe programı olarak ETA SQL v8 kullanıyor ve sql bilgisi olmadan raporlamalarda zorluk çekiyoruz. Ben bir el atayım dedim. Videoların desteğiyle bir yere kadar öğrendim fakat istediğim raporun her hangi bir örneğine rastlamadım.

Sorun şu şekilde

Görseldeki borç alacak kolonundaki 1 ler borç 2 ler alacak hanesi olarak depolanıyor. Ben carikoda göre borç ve alacak hanelerinin toplamlarını ayrı sütunlarda görüntülemek istiyorum. Sorguda tarihte var ama aslında ikinci bir sorun gibi düşünülebilir. İki tarih arasında veri çekmek istiyorum.
Excel'den Microsoft Query ile veri çekip orada da düzenleme yapmayı denesem de, tarih kıstası elimi kolumu bağladı.

Örneğin: 01.01.2014 ve 31.01.2014 tarihleri arasında hangi firmanın ne kadar borcu ne kadar alacağı var?

adsız1

Alıntı:
SELECT
CARHARTAR TARİH,
CARHARCARKOD [CARİ KODU],
CARHARCARUNVAN [CARİ ÜNVANI],
CARHARGCFLAG [BORÇ ALACAK],
CARHARTUTAR TUTAR
FROM CARHAR
mehmetzekikir  
#2 Gönderildi : 16 Eylül 2016 Cuma 08:56:09(UTC)
mehmetzekikir

Sıralama: Administration

Gruplar: Administrators
Katılan: 6.05.2014(UTC)
Mesajlar: 670

19 Kere Teşekkür Etti.
152 Mesajına Toplam 253 Kere Teşekkür Edildi.
Originally Posted by: Gkhn Go to Quoted Post
Merhabalar

SQL ile amatörce ilgilenme devresinde Mehmet Zeki Kır bey'in youtube'taki videolarına rastladım. Verimli anlatımları için hem teşekkür etmek istedim, hem de bir soru sormak istedim.

Şirketimiz muhasebe programı olarak ETA SQL v8 kullanıyor ve sql bilgisi olmadan raporlamalarda zorluk çekiyoruz. Ben bir el atayım dedim. Videoların desteğiyle bir yere kadar öğrendim fakat istediğim raporun her hangi bir örneğine rastlamadım.

Sorun şu şekilde

Görseldeki borç alacak kolonundaki 1 ler borç 2 ler alacak hanesi olarak depolanıyor. Ben carikoda göre borç ve alacak hanelerinin toplamlarını ayrı sütunlarda görüntülemek istiyorum. Sorguda tarihte var ama aslında ikinci bir sorun gibi düşünülebilir. İki tarih arasında veri çekmek istiyorum.
Excel'den Microsoft Query ile veri çekip orada da düzenleme yapmayı denesem de, tarih kıstası elimi kolumu bağladı.

Örneğin: 01.01.2014 ve 31.01.2014 tarihleri arasında hangi firmanın ne kadar borcu ne kadar alacağı var?

adsız1

Alıntı:
SELECT
CARHARTAR TARİH,
CARHARCARKOD [CARİ KODU],
CARHARCARUNVAN [CARİ ÜNVANI],
CARHARGCFLAG [BORÇ ALACAK],
CARHARTUTAR TUTAR
FROM CARHAR


Merhabalar

Şu şekilde yapabilirsiniz,

-- BORC
Kod:
SELECT 
			CARHARCARKOD [CARİ KODU],
			CARHARCARUNVAN [CARİ ÜNVANI],
			SUM(CARHARTUTAR) TUTAR
FROM CARHAR
WHERE CARHARGCFLAG=1 AND CARHARTAR BETWEEN '01.01.2014' ANAD '31.01.2014'
GROUP BY CARHARCARKOD ,CARHARCARUNVAN 


--ALACAK
Kod:
SELECT 
			CARHARCARKOD [CARİ KODU],
			CARHARCARUNVAN [CARİ ÜNVANI],
			SUM(CARHARTUTAR) TUTAR
FROM CARHAR
WHERE CARHARGCFLAG=2 AND CARHARTAR BETWEEN '01.01.2014' ANAD '31.01.2014'
GROUP BY CARHARCARKOD ,CARHARCARUNVAN 

Düzenle Kullanıcı Tarafından 16 Eylül 2016 Cuma 08:57:15(UTC)  | Sebep: Sebep Bildirilmesi

Sql Server 2016 Eğitimiz 19 Mayıs tarihinde başlayacaktır. 32 Saat Olup Ücret 1450 TL + KDV'dir. Kayıt ve ayrıntılar için tıklayınız

twitter.com/dbakademi
Dua ve teşekkür en büyük servetlere bedel...
Gkhn  
#3 Gönderildi : 16 Eylül 2016 Cuma 12:12:03(UTC)
Gkhn

Sıralama: Newbie

Gruplar: Registered
Katılan: 8.09.2016(UTC)
Mesajlar: 2
Turkey

Msg 242, Level 16, State 3, Line 1
The conversion of a varchar data type to a datetime data type resulted in an out-of-range value.


Böyle bir hata verdi

2014-01-14 00:00:00.000
2014-01-03 00:00:00.000
2014-01-03 00:00:00.000
2014-01-17 00:00:00.000
2014-01-18 00:00:00.000
2014-01-03 00:00:00.000
2014-01-03 00:00:00.000
2014-01-03 00:00:00.000
2014-01-10 00:00:00.000

Tarihler bu şekilde. Acaba bununla mı ilgili?
mehmetzekikir  
#4 Gönderildi : 17 Eylül 2016 Cumartesi 20:25:42(UTC)
mehmetzekikir

Sıralama: Administration

Gruplar: Administrators
Katılan: 6.05.2014(UTC)
Mesajlar: 670

19 Kere Teşekkür Etti.
152 Mesajına Toplam 253 Kere Teşekkür Edildi.
Evet ondan dolayi cast islemi yapaniz lazim
Sql Server 2016 Eğitimiz 19 Mayıs tarihinde başlayacaktır. 32 Saat Olup Ücret 1450 TL + KDV'dir. Kayıt ve ayrıntılar için tıklayınız

twitter.com/dbakademi
Dua ve teşekkür en büyük servetlere bedel...


Bu konudaki kullanıcılar
Guest (2)
Forumu Atla  
Bu foruma yeni konular postalayamazsınız.
Bu forumda ki konulara yeni posta gönderemezsiniz.
Bu forumdaki postalarınızı silemezsiniz.
Bu forumdaki postalarınızı düzenleyemezsiniz.
Bu forumda anketler yaratamazsınız.
Bu forumdaki anketlere oy veremezsiniz.